Actually in the real world of financial market and institutions, money is never just piled up inside a big vault, but constantly been lent out and circulated into house holds (real cash is usually very low, but in the form of deposits or securities). We probably need a whole new financial mechanism in game to represent the gigantic financial sector. The "bank" in game is really not functioned like in real world (It's really not just supply and demand for cash).
Maybe some mechanism of bond market can be implemented. Corporate bonds and other bills, even city or state issued ones can be interesting additions to the game.
